I fished for 8 hours on the Friday of the long weekend for one hit none landed. #Launched at Kirkleigh and went staight to the spit

Came across some great bait balls around the spit towards the no-go zone near the dam wall.

Some bait balls were so dense the middle looked solid. #Tried soft plastics, spinnerbaits, trolling, jigging for not a touch. #

Tried a number of places heading back to the Kirkleigh for no action.

The hump has still got the For Sale on it but I don't know if it has sold yet. Try the flats opposite the hump.

If you go to Bay 13 try the deep water at the mouth.

Be careful the water is very shallow and there are many many logs for you to run into. Yes, the skiers are still on the dam risking life and limb in the shallows

We went up a couple of weeks ago. The weather wasn't the greatest as the wind picked up reasonably early and made it quite difficult with the lighter gear. We ( the missus and I) managed to pick up around 20 bass ( all realeased ) 12 of which being over legal, 3 being over 40cm, so all in all it wasn't a bad session.
We found alot of them were schooling up in the shallows. Especially around kirkleagh! Black and red spinners were the go.
The spit wasn't really active.

Launching your boat wasn't so bad as long as you took care and had half a brain you can't go wrong and the same goes for driving around in your boat. A few hidden and exposed stumps. I still to this day don't understand why people are still skiing there!
